ChatClear+ - Das ultimative Chat-Management-Plugin für deinen Server!
Bist du es leid, dass der Chat deines Servers mit Spam und unerwünschten Nachrichten überflutet wird? ChatClear+ ist das perfekte Plugin für Server-Admins, die volle Kontrolle über den Chat haben möchten! Mit einem umfassenden Anti-Spam-System, einem leistungsstarken Chat-Clear-Tool und flexiblen Einstellungsmöglichkeiten in der Konfigurationsdatei ist ChatClear+ das ultimative Tool, um den Chat sauber und ordentlich zu halten.
Hauptfunktionen Einfache Chat-Clear-Funktion
Ein-Klick-Chat-Clear: Löscht den Chat für alle Spieler mit nur einem Befehl!
Countdown vor dem Clear: Eine Countdown-Anzeige benachrichtigt alle Spieler vor dem Chat-Clearing, damit niemand überrascht wird.
Flexible Clear-Optionen: Konfigurierbare Nachricht für das Clear-Event, die anzeigt, wer den Chat gelöscht hat.
Erweiterte Berechtigungen
Clear-Berechtigungen: Nur autorisierte Spieler oder Admins können den Chat löschen.
Sichtbarkeitsoptionen für Admins: Der Chat kann nur für bestimmte Spieler sichtbar bleiben, selbst nach dem Clear (ideal für Moderatoren und Admins).
Intelligentes Anti-Spam-System
Spam-Erkennung: Verhindert, dass Spieler identische Nachrichten innerhalb kurzer Zeit senden.
Anpassbare Spam-Nachricht: Server-Admins können die Benachrichtigung bei Spam ganz einfach in der Konfiguration anpassen.
Zeitintervall-Option: Stelle das Intervall ein, innerhalb dessen doppelte Nachrichten blockiert werden.
Logging für vollständige Kontrolle
Automatisches Logging: Speichert Chat-Verläufe in einer Logdatei, bevor der Chat gelöscht wird – ideal für spätere Überprüfungen.
Einstellbares Log-Verzeichnis: Admins können festlegen, wo die Logdatei gespeichert werden soll.
# Konfigurationsdatei für ChatClearPlugin
# Einstellungen für das Anti-Spam-System
anti-spam:
enabled: true # Aktiviert oder deaktiviert die Anti-Spam-Erkennung
spam-interval: 3000 # Zeitintervall in Millisekunden für gleiche Nachrichten
spam-message: "Du sendest zu schnell die gleiche Nachricht. Bitte warte kurz." # Nachricht bei Spam-Erkennung
# Einstellungen für das ChatClear-System
chat-clear:
enabled: true # Aktiviert oder deaktiviert das Chat-Clear-System
countdown: 15 # Countdown-Zeit in Sekunden vor dem Löschen des Chats
clear-message: "Der Chat wurde von {player} gelöscht." # Nachricht nach dem Chat-Clearing
admin-view-only: false # Wenn true, bleibt der Chat nur für Admins sichtbar
permission:
use: "chatclear.use" # Berechtigung, um den Chat zu löschen
view: "chatclear.view" # Berechtigung, um den Chat weiterhin zu sehen
# Logging-Einstellungen
logging:
enabled: true # Aktiviert oder deaktiviert das Logging der gelöschten Nachrichten
log-file: "chatlog.txt" # Name der Logdatei, in der Chat-Verläufe gespeichert werden